summaryrefslogtreecommitdiff
path: root/android/2.0
diff options
context:
space:
mode:
authorSaurabh Srivastava <ssrivast@codeaurora.org>2019-03-13 16:47:02 +0530
committerSaurabh Srivastava <ssrivast@codeaurora.org>2019-03-13 16:47:02 +0530
commitac8ce3c7d5b189a55c9de4ae31b50fa9adb20ddd (patch)
tree6023263221792c1db3d0a4dfe8e7cbac54171d20 /android/2.0
parent1b6ad38fb95b904d30ec870efcbc8f46e81b76ba (diff)
downloadgps-ac8ce3c7d5b189a55c9de4ae31b50fa9adb20ddd.tar.gz
Dummy impl for injectBestLocation_2_0
Change-Id: I37a96ee52dea4bce92bb741bf0be79279ec86d67
Diffstat (limited to 'android/2.0')
-rw-r--r--android/2.0/Gnss.cpp8
-rw-r--r--android/2.0/Gnss.h3
2 files changed, 11 insertions, 0 deletions
diff --git a/android/2.0/Gnss.cpp b/android/2.0/Gnss.cpp
index 0a4b34b..0c9519f 100644
--- a/android/2.0/Gnss.cpp
+++ b/android/2.0/Gnss.cpp
@@ -488,6 +488,14 @@ Return<sp<::android::hardware::gnss::visibility_control::V1_0::IGnssVisibilityCo
}
return mVisibCtrl;
}
+
+Return<bool> Gnss::injectBestLocation_2_0(
+ const ::android::hardware::gnss::V2_0::GnssLocation& location) {
+ ENTRY_LOG_CALLFLOW();
+ /* TBD */
+ return false;
+}
+
IGnss* HIDL_FETCH_IGnss(const char* hal) {
ENTRY_LOG_CALLFLOW();
IGnss* iface = nullptr;
diff --git a/android/2.0/Gnss.h b/android/2.0/Gnss.h
index bef1e3a..b0a4f91 100644
--- a/android/2.0/Gnss.h
+++ b/android/2.0/Gnss.h
@@ -119,6 +119,9 @@ struct Gnss : public IGnss {
Return<sp<::android::hardware::gnss::measurement_corrections::V1_0::IMeasurementCorrections>>
getExtensionMeasurementCorrections() override;
Return<sp<V2_0::IGnssMeasurement>> getExtensionGnssMeasurement_2_0() override;
+
+ Return<bool> injectBestLocation_2_0(const ::android::hardware::gnss::V2_0::GnssLocation& location) override;
+
/**
* This method returns the IGnssVisibilityControl interface.
*